Transaction e2da61a27633716d9228f3b098311531897eba1e9f00788e2baa25d8c24cd229
1 Input
1 Output
-
e2da61a27633716d9228f3b098311531897eba1e9f00788e2baa25d8c24cd229:0
- value
- 9942539
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fb0be4322a24298124cdb847876bab4d5817442
- address
- bc1qe7ctusez5fpfsyjvmwz8sa46kn2czazzx4qzh9